When to go

The best time to surf in Colombia is from May to October for the Pacific coast and from November to March for the Caribbean side. Therefore, at any given moment throughout the year, you should be able to find a wave to surf in Colombia.

 

 

Where to stay

The Pacific coastline of Colombia is still a pretty rugged area with a lot of nature and parks. Therefore, there aren’t that many hotels on the coast. Nuqui is a great place to stay on a surf trip to Colombia with many surf spots around the area and some vacation rentals as well as hotels to chose from.

Surf spots in Colombia

El Valle

El Valle is a remote surf spot located on Colombia’s Pacific coast, known for its powerful beach breaks and uncrowded waves. The waves break both left and right over a sandy bottom, offering solid rides for intermediate and advanced surfers. When south swells combine with light northeast winds, El Valle can produce some of the best waves in the area.

  • Wave direction : Left and right
  • Bottom : Sand
  • Best tide : Any
  • Skill level : Intermediate and advanced
  • Optimal swell direction : S
  • Optimal wind direction : NE

 

 

Playa Guachalito

Playa Guachalito is a more accessible and forgiving surf spot, making it a great option for surfers of all levels. The sandy beach break offers both left and right waves that work best on southwest swells with easterly winds. The beautiful, lush jungle backdrop and mellow vibes make it an excellent destination for a relaxed surf session.

  • Wave Direction: Left and right
  • Bottom: Sand
  • Best Tide: Any
  • Skill Level: All levels
  • Optimal Swell Direction: Southwest
  • Optimal Wind Direction: East

 

 

 

Juan Tornillo

Juan Tornillo is a consistent beach break suited for intermediate and advanced surfers looking for punchy, fast waves. It offers peaks with both left and right rides that can get heavy on solid southwest swells. The sandy bottom keeps it approachable, but the wave power and shape are best suited for surfers with some experience.

  • Wave Direction: Left and right
  • Bottom: Sand
  • Best Tide: Any
  • Skill Level: Intermediate and advanced
  • Optimal Swell Direction: Southwest
  • Optimal Wind Direction: Northeast

 

 

Juanchaco

Juanchaco is a powerful, secluded right-hand reef break that’s best reserved for advanced surfers. When north swells meet favorable southeast winds, Juanchaco can deliver long, hollow waves that challenge even experienced riders. Its isolation and intensity make it one of Colombia’s most rewarding yet demanding surf spots.

  • Wave Direction: Right
  • Bottom: Reef
  • Best Tide: Any
  • Skill Level: Advanced
  • Optimal Swell Direction: North
  • Optimal Wind Direction: Southeast
